In vitro Propagation and Protocorm-like Body Formation of Endangered Species, Dendrobium moniliforme
This experiment was conducted to establish the in vitro propagation of Dendrobium moniliforme through protocorm like body (PLB) induction from the culture of leaf, stem and root explants. Frequency of PLB formation from root explants was higher than those of leaf and stem explants. PLB’s proliferation in MS medium including 1.0 mg/L NAA was better than 1.0 mg/L IBA. Frequency of PLB’s proliferation on medium with various concentrations of BA, Kinetin, Tidiazuron (0. 1.0, 3.0 mg/L) and NAA (0, 1.0 mg/L) was tested. The maximun proliferation of PLB’s was obtained on MS medium supplemented with 3.0 mg/L BA and 1.0 mg/L NAA after 6 weeks of culture. Addition of 200 mg/L activated charcoal (AC) and 30 g/L sucrose was effective on PLB proliferation for D. moniliforme.
